High Tariffs
Government-imposed taxes on imported or exported goods intended to protect domestic industries, but can lead to international trade disputes.
Freedom From Want
A concept popularized by President Franklin D. Roosevelt as one of the Four Freedoms, referring to the right to an adequate standard of living and economic security.
Consumerism
The theory or policy that promotes an increasing consumption of goods as an economic policy or social system.
Standard Of Living
Refers to the level of wealth, comfort, material goods, and necessities available to a certain socioeconomic class or geographic area.
